gh-118433: Temporarily skip `test_interrupt_main_subthread` in free-threaded builds (#118485)
Free-threaded builds can intermittently tickle a longstanding bug (24 years!) in the implementation of `threading.Condition`, leading to flakiness in the test suite. Fixing the underlying issue will require more discussion, and will likely apply to most of the concurrency primitives in the `threading` module that are written in Python. See gh-118433 for more details.
